The HSE is urging people to check if they have a functioning first aid kit in their homes over the Christmas period.
Almost 2,000 cases of Covid-19, RSV and influenza have been recorded nationally in the past week.
Across the festive period, the Local Injury Unit at Ennis Hospital will remain open from 8am to 8pm, while the Medical Assessment Unit at the facility will stay operational from 8am to 12 midnight, and University Hospital Limerick’s Emergency Department will be open 24/7 as normal.
HSE Midwest Integrated Healthcare Area Manager Maria Bridgeman has been telling Clare FM’s Seán Lyons it’s important to have basic first aid equipment as well as cold and flu remedies in the event that someone starts to feel unwell in the coming days.
